If you have a cyclamen plant, you may have noticed small, round, brown or grayish bumps on the leaves and stems. These bumps are actually scales, which are small insects that feed on the sap of the plant. If left untreated, scales can cause damage to the plant and even kill it. In this article, we will discuss how to get rid of scales on cyclamen plant.
Identifying Scales on Cyclamen Plant
Scales are small insects that are usually brown or grayish in color. They attach themselves to the leaves and stems of plants and feed on the sap. If you notice small, round bumps on your cyclamen plant, it is likely that you have a scale infestation.
How to Get Rid of Scales on Cyclamen Plant
- Inspect your plant
The first step in getting rid of scales on your cyclamen plant is to inspect it thoroughly. Look for any signs of infestation such as small bumps on the leaves and stems.
- Remove the Scales Manually
If the infestation is not severe, you can remove the scales manually by gently scraping them off with a soft-bristled brush or cloth. Be careful not to damage the plant while doing this.
- Use Horticultural Oil
Horticultural oil can be an effective way to get rid of scales on your cyclamen plant. Apply it to the affected areas according to the instructions on the label.
- Use Insecticidal Soap
Insecticidal soap is another option for getting rid of scales on your cyclamen plant. It works by suffocating the insects. Apply it to the affected areas according to the instructions on the label.
- Use Neem Oil
Neem oil is a natural insecticide that can be effective in getting rid of scales on your cyclamen plant. Mix it with water according to the instructions on the label and apply it to the affected areas.
- Repeat the Treatment
Repeat the treatment every 7-10 days until the scales are completely gone.
Tips for Preventing Scale Infestations
-
Keep your plants healthy by watering them regularly and providing them with adequate sunlight.
-
Inspect your plants regularly for signs of infestation.
-
Remove any dead leaves or stems from your plant as they can attract insects.
-
Quarantine any new plants before introducing them to your existing plants to prevent the spread of pests.
-
Use natural methods such as ladybugs or lacewings to control insect populations in your garden.
